UK P&I Club news alert The UK P&I Club has been advised that vessels are continuing to be detained due to inoperative water mist systems.There have been a total of 20 detentions due the inoperative water mist systems in the USA. In each case, the water supply valve was found in the closed position during the PSC examination, essentially rendering the water mist system "not readily available for immediate use".In many of the cases, the Chief Engineer did not know that the water supply valve was in the closed position and was left in the closed position during maintenance.It is highly advisable to make frequent rounds and inspections of the water mist system, paying close attention to valve alignment as well as ensuring that there is adequate labelling so that existing and new crew members will know that the critical fixed fire fighting must be made available for immediate use.Source: The UK P&I Club Also read relevant Safety4Sea articleRecent US PSC Detentions on Water Mist Systems
